Come and join our team. We are looking for a talented person to join the HR Team supporting the Family and Specialist Services (FaSS) Division. This role will be permanent.

We are looking for people with a positive, proactive, inclusive, flexible, ‘can-do’ attitude; ideally you will have a good knowledge of employment law and strong experience of resolving people management queries and issues. We will expect you to be a positive role model for our values - ‘Everyone matters’, ‘Working together’, ‘Making a difference’ - and to promote best practice in people management. You should be CIPD Level 5 qualified or working towards this qualification; this diverse role will allow you to further develop your people management skills in a supportive yet challenging environment.

Please note that this job role will require you to be on-site for at least one day a week.

1. To act as the first point of contact for all HR queries for their delegated area, redirecting queries appropriately where necessary within their HR Team.
